W.A.M.Y. Community Action, Inc. - Weatherization Assistance Program

W.A.M.Y. is a community action organization administering heating appliance repair (HARRP), emergency bill assistance (LIHEAP), the Weatherization Assistance Program (WAP) and more to low-income households in Watauga, Avery, Mitchell, and Yancey Counties of North Carolina.

SolSmart National Designation Program

The SolSmart solar program is a national designation program, funded by the Department of Energy, to recognize communities removing barriers and promoting solar by making it easier and more affordable to install systems.
